TALLAHASSEE, Fla. — The annual Florida Public Relations Association (FPRA) PR & Comms Summit took place in Orlando from August 9-12, 2026. With more than 1,000 members across 15 chapters, FPRA is the oldest public relations association in the United States. This year, two members of SalterMitchell PR (SMPR) were installed to leadership roles and recognized for their continued service in the communications industry.
Founder and CEO of SalterMitchell PR April Salter, APR, CPRC has assumed the role of FPRA state president. In this position, she will lead the executive committee and board of directors, implementing her strategic vision for the association and driving professional growth across all regional chapters statewide.

“After more than two decades with FPRA, serving as state president feels like a natural progression to give back to the community that helped mold me,” said April Salter, APR, CPRC. “One of my goals is to form deeper connections within FPRA by helping members build stronger relationships across the state, learn from one another and feel supported in the work they do every day.”
PR and Public Affairs Director Lexie Savedge, APR now serves as president of FPRA’s Tampa Bay Chapter. In this role, she will guide the local chapter’s board of directors in delivering monthly professional development events, networking opportunities and regional growth initiatives for public relations practitioners across Tampa Bay.

“It’s an honor to serve as president of FPRA’s Tampa Bay Chapter and extra special to do so under the statewide leadership of our firm’s founder, April Salter,” said Lexie Savedge, APR. “FPRA has played an important role in my leadership development and I’m excited to build a stronger chapter in Tampa Bay by connecting communications professionals and helping members grow in their own roles.”
